Ridley Pierce doesn't believe in justice.
She didn't find any when she was a child, and nothing she's seen since has changed her mind. She makes her home as far away from her dark past as she could find, spending her days restoring motorcycles and her nights handing out her own brand of justice to abused women, using her powers on the people who aren't big enough villains for the Legion of the Guards to worry about.
When a team from the Legion interrupts her take down of an abusive creep masquerading as a hero and arrests her, she's thrust into the world she's long avoided. A world of heroes and villains.
Ridley has no interest in being a hero or joining the Legion.
But the villain the team is after is just the sort of scumbag she loves to take down and the four guys after him want her help.
She has to decide if she's ready to step out of her shadows and nightmares or remain trapped by her past.
*IMPORTANT NOTE: This is a reverse harem novel where the leading lady doesn't have to choose between love interests. The series will have MM themes and is intended for mature audiences due to graphic content.
**Trigger warning for abuse and assault.
